completion %
66.1 -> 63.6

Yards / Attempt
9 -> 6.9

Yards / Completion
13.6 -> 10.8

Yards / Game
255.2 -> 226.4

Rating
157.2 -> 130.1


Worse in every category. Even more notable when you consider last year's number include the full schedule and we haven't hit the tough part of the schedule yet this year.

Comp % difference is not dramatic

9 yards per attempt is good. 6.9 is below average. This is a significant dropoff.

29 yards per game is about 3 first downs. In many, or most, games, 3 more first downs equates to an additional score.

27 drop in QB rating is pretty significant. From good to average. That's top 40 versus 80-something.
